Transaction 1539fc0a63a1afa818091a91a84f6566e935823f5fc1401ea26821d3a0b031f9

1 Input
2 Outputs
  • 1539fc0a63a1afa818091a91a84f6566e935823f5fc1401ea26821d3a0b031f9:0
  • value  38214720
    address  12o97dFwT6yPGkFJHzVbNSjafP7zhz22xA
  • 1539fc0a63a1afa818091a91a84f6566e935823f5fc1401ea26821d3a0b031f9:1
  • value  774850605
    address  bc1q32sxnq5hecdurfzgzp5x0zh8du86v9x84wdqdx